Output 589a35ea193bcd803ad2df7162f3291101bc426c97d869b2fe4a1b703526cbbf:68

value
632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8866f9108405ca3eb5b854f99b12b56cf851b97ce0b66b1d07f69f7c31fa44a
address
bc1pmzrxlygggpw2866ms48envft2m8c2xuhec9kdvws0a5l0scl539qskaz6j
transaction
589a35ea193bcd803ad2df7162f3291101bc426c97d869b2fe4a1b703526cbbf
spent
true